HB3285 by Guillen (Relating to considering the assessment instrument results of certain students in evaluating school district and campus performance.), As Introduced

No fiscal implication to the State is anticipated.

The bill would prohibit the consideration of student performance on a state assessment in evaluating school districts and campus performance in the state accountability system for three years for students identified as having limited English proficiency.

Local Government Impact

School districts would not have the assessment results of students with limited English proficiency included in their accountability ratings for campuses and districts for a period of three years. The bill does not state when that three year window begins.
